    Review Summary

    The following is an AI generated summary of the reviews of the community from across the web.

    Reviews of Corsica Hills reveal a mixed bag of experiences, ranging from high praise for the staff's professionalism and care to serious concerns about cleanliness and patient neglect. Positive comments highlight the dedication and kindness of the nursing staff, physical therapists, and administrative personnel, with specific mentions of the director of marketing and admissions, Anna Lill, for her exceptional work ethic and positive impact on both company morale and service quality. Many reviewers appreciated the facility's ability to provide excellent rehabilitation services, noting the effectiveness of the physical therapy, the quality of the food, and the overall caring attitude of the staff.

    However, several reviews raise significant concerns about aspects of patient care and facility management. Issues include a lack of communication about patients' health conditions, difficulties in dietary management for specific health needs, and allegations of neglect leading to severe health complications such as a flesh-eating bacteria infection. Complaints about cleanliness, understaffing, and staff attentiveness, particularly regarding the use of personal phones during work hours, were also noted. Some reviewers expressed dissatisfaction with the hiring practices and alleged discrimination.

    Despite these concerns, many families expressed gratitude for the care their loved ones received, mentioning the facility's friendly atmosphere and the staff's willingness to go above and beyond in providing care. The facility was praised for its clean and well-maintained environment, and several reviewers indicated they would choose Corsica Hills again for rehabilitation or care needs.

    In summary, while Corsica Hills has been lauded for its caring staff and effective rehabilitation services, it also faces criticism regarding aspects of patient care, cleanliness, and communication. Prospective residents and their families may want to consider these reviews carefully and possibly visit the facility to make an informed decision.

    Health and Fire Safety Deficiencies

    The Center for Medicare and Medicaid report health and fire safety deficiencies. Some of these deficiencies are more severe than others. The following table shows different levels of severity.

    Scope
    Severity of Deficiency Isolated Pattern Widespread
    Immediate jeopardy to resident health or safety J K L
    Actual harm that is not immediate jeopardy G H I
    No actual harm with potential for more than minimal harm that is not immediate jeopardy D E F
    No actual harm with potential for minimal harm A B C
